Abstract
Background Although the correlation between substance use disorder and attention deficit hyperactivity disorder (ADHD) has been largely studied, less is known about the correlation between behavioral addictions and ADHD. Thus, the aim of the present study was to investigate the prevalence of behavioral addictions in a large sample of adult patients with a primary diagnosis of ADHD and to compare the clinical profile of ADHD patients with and without behavioral addictions comorbidity. Methods 248 consecutive adults newly diagnosed as ADHD patients were assessed through a series of validated scales for gambling disorder, internet, sex, shopping and food addictions. ADHD patients with at least one comorbid behavioral addiction were compared to non-comorbid patients on ADHD symptoms, impulsivity, mood and anxiety symptoms and functional impairment. Results 58.9% of patients had at least one behavioral addiction comorbidity. Of the whole sample, 31.9% of the patients had a comorbidity with one behavioral addiction while the 27% showed a comorbidity with two or more behavioral addictions. Internet addiction was the most common comorbidity (33.9%) followed by food addiction (28.6%), shopping addiction (19%), sex addiction (12.9%) and gambling disorder (3.6%). ADHD patients with comorbid behavioral addictions showed higher ADHD current and childhood symptoms, higher cognitive and motor impulsivity, higher mood and anxiety symptoms and higher functional impairment. Conclusions Behavioral addictions are highly frequent in adult ADHD patients. Comorbid patients seem to have a more complex phenotype characterized by more severe ADHD, mood and anxiety symptoms, higher impulsivity levels and greater functional impairment.

Abstract
BACKGROUND The incidence of behavioral addictions (BAs) associated with scientific and technological advances has been increasing steadily. Unfortunately, a large number of studies on the structural and functional abnormalities have shown poor reproducibility, and it remains unclear whether different addictive behaviors share common underlying abnormalities. Therefore, our objective was to conduct a quantitative meta-analysis of different behavioral addictions to provide evidence-based evidence of common structural and functional changes. METHODS We conducted systematic searches in PubMed, Web of Science and Scopus from January 2010 to December 2023, supplementing reference lists of high-quality relevant meta-analyses and reviews, to identify eligible voxel-based morphometry (VBM) and functional magnetic resonance imaging (fMRI) studies. Using anisotropic seed-based D-Mapping (AES-SDM) meta-analysis methods, we compared brain abnormalities between BAs and healthy controls (HCs). RESULTS There were 11 GMV studies (287 BAs and 292 HCs) and 26 fMRI studies (577 BAs and 545 HCs) that met inclusion criteria. Compared with HCs, BAs demonstrated significant reductions in gray matter volume (GMV) in (1) right anterior cingulate gyri extending into the adjacent superior frontal gyrus, as well as in the left inferior frontal gyrus and right striatum. (2) the bilateral precuneus, right supramarginal gyrus, and right fusiform gyrus were hyperfunction; (3) the left medial cingulate gyrus extended to the superior frontal gyrus, the left inferior frontal gyrus, and right middle temporal gyrus had hypofunction. CONCLUSIONS Our study identified structural and functional impairments in brain regions involved in executive control, cognitive function, visual memory, and reward-driven behavior in BAs. Notably, fronto-cingulate regions may serve as common biomarkers of BAs.

Abstract
BACKGROUND Researchers have endeavored to ascertain the network dysfunction associated with behavioral addiction (BA) through the utilization of resting-state functional connectivity (rsFC). Nevertheless, the identification of aberrant patterns within large-scale networks pertaining to BA has proven to be challenging. METHODS Whole-brain seed-based rsFC studies comparing subjects with BA and healthy controls (HC) were collected from multiple databases. Multilevel kernel density analysis was employed to ascertain brain networks in which BA was linked to hyper-connectivity or hypo-connectivity with each prior network. RESULTS Fifty-six seed-based rsFC publications (1755 individuals with BA and 1828 HC) were included in the meta-analysis. The present study indicate that individuals with BAs exhibit (1) hypo-connectivity within the fronto-parietal network (FN) and hypo- and hyper-connectivity within the ventral attention network (VAN); (2) hypo-connectivity between the FN and regions of the VAN, hypo-connectivity between the VAN and regions of the FN and default mode network (DMN), hyper-connectivity between the DMN and regions of the FN; (3) hypo-connectivity between the reward system and regions of the sensorimotor network (SS), DMN and VAN; (4) hypo-connectivity between the FN and regions of the SS, hyper-connectivity between the VAN and regions of the SS. CONCLUSIONS These findings provide impetus for a conceptual framework positing a model of BA characterized by disconnected functional coordination among large-scale networks.

Abstract
BACKGROUND This study examined the association between Adverse Childhood Experiences (ACEs) and Gambling Severity (gambling severity), considering the mediating roles of internalizing, externalizing, and attention among youth online gamblers. METHODS 762 youth (agemean±SD= 15.03 ± 2.40; agerange = 10-18 years; 75.3% boys) completed the Persian Gambling Disorder Screening Questionnaire (GDSQ-P), Pediatric Symptom Checklist - Youth Report (Y-PSC), and Behavioral Risk Factor Surveillance System Questionnaire (ACE's section, modified by authors). The analysis was done using the SMART PLS software. RESULTS The reliability and discriminant validity of the provided model were assessed using Partial Least Squares-Structural Equation Modeling (PLS-SEM). According to the results of the PLS-SEM analysis, the present model demonstrated suitable levels of reliability and validity. Adverse Childhood Experiences (ACEs) significantly affected attention, internalizing, externalizing problems, and gambling severity. Additionally, the level of gambling was directly correlated with ACEs. Moreover, the indirect influence of the independent variable on the dependent variable via the mediators was found to be statistically significant (P < .001).These findings suggest that externalizing behaviors, attention problems, and internalizing symptoms mediate the effect of ACEs on gambling severity. Lastly, fitness indices indicated that our proposed model fit the data well (SRMR = 0.06, d_ULS = 1.15, Chi-square = 1291.461, and NFI = 0.71). CONCLUSION Our study found that ACEs significantly influence gambling severity among youth online gamblers, with internalizing, externalizing, and attention problems mediating this relationship. Practical implications include integrating ACE screening and targeted interventions for associated mental health issues into youth gambling prevention programs to mitigate the risk of problematic gambling behavior.

Abstract
The influence of socioeconomic status (SES) on risk of Problem Gambling (PG) is complex, particularly given recent evidence that SES should be understood in both objective and subjective terms. Likewise, financial gambling motives have been found to be predictive of PG; however, financial motives are less understood in comparison to other gambling motives. Preliminary findings on SES and gambling points towards a pattern of social inequality in which those with the least financial resources (e.g., income) or that feel financially deprived relative to others (e.g., perceived deprivation) experience greater harm and problems. In a weighted, census matched sample of adults in the U.S. (N = 1,348), the present study examined the interaction between financial gambling motives and income and financial gambling motives and perceived deprivation in predicting PG. Findings provided support for both financial gambling motives and perceived deprivation as robust predictors of PG. Further, results provided unique insights into the role subjective economic standing may play in the relationship between financial motives for gambling and risk of PG.

Abstract
Gambling Disorder (GD) is an impactful behavioural addiction for which there appear to be underpinning genetic contributors. Twin studies show significant GD heritability results and intergenerational transmission show high rates of transmission. Recent developments in polygenic and multifactorial risk prediction modelling provide promising opportunities to enable early identification and intervention for at risk individuals. People with GD often have significant delays in diagnosis and subsequent help-seeking that can compromise their recovery. In this paper we advocate for more research into the utility of polygenic and multifactorial risk modelling in GD research and treatment programs and rigorous evaluation of its costs and benefits.

Abstract
Consistent evidence points to the detrimental effects of income inequality on population health. Income inequality may be associated with online gambling, which is of concern since gambling is a risk factor for adverse mental health conditions, such as depression and suicide ideation. Thus, the overall objective of this study is to study the role of income inequality on the odds of participating in online gambling. Data from 74,501 students attending 136 schools participating in the 2018/2019 Cannabis, Obesity, Mental health, Physical activity, Alcohol, Smoking, and Sedentary behaviour (COMPASS) survey were used. The Gini coefficient was calculated based on school census divisions (CD) using the Canada 2016 Census linked with student data. We used multilevel modeling to explore the association between income inequality and self-reported participation in online gambling in the last 30 days, while controlling for individual- and area-level characteristics. We examined whether mental health (depressive and anxiety symptoms, psychosocial wellbeing), school connectedness, and access to mental health programs mediate this relationship. Adjusted analysis indicated that a standardized deviation (SD) unit increase in Gini coefficient (OR = 1.17, 95% CI 1.05, 1.30) was associated with increased odds of participating in online gambling. When stratified by gender, the association was significant only among males (OR = 1.12, 95% CI 1.03, 1.22). The relationship between higher income inequality and greater odds for online gambling may be mediated by depressive and anxiety symptoms, psychosocial well-being, and school connectedness. Evidence points to further health consequences, such as online gambling participation, stemming from exposure to income inequality.

Abstract
Impulse control disorders (ICDs), a wide spectrum of maladaptive behaviors which includes pathological gambling, hypersexuality and compulsive buying, have been recently suggested to be triggered or aggravated by treatments with dopamine D2/3 receptor agonists, such as pramipexole (PPX). Despite evidence showing that impulsivity is associated with functional alterations in corticostriatal networks, the neural basis of the exacerbation of impulsivity by PPX has not been elucidated. Here we used a hotspot analysis to assess the functional recruitment of several corticostriatal structures by PPX in male rats identified as highly (HI), moderately impulsive (MI) or with low levels of impulsivity (LI) in the 5-choice serial reaction time task (5-CSRTT). PPX dramatically reduced impulsivity in HI rats. Assessment of the expression pattern of the two immediate early genes C-fos and Zif268 by in situ hybridization subsequently revealed that PPX resulted in a decrease in Zif268 mRNA levels in different striatal regions of both LI and HI rats accompanied by a high impulsivity specific reduction of Zif268 mRNA levels in prelimbic and cingulate cortices. PPX also decreased C-fos mRNA levels in all striatal regions of LI rats, but only in the dorsolateral striatum and nucleus accumbens core (NAc Core) of HI rats. Structural equation modeling further suggested that the anti-impulsive effect of PPX was mainly attributable to the specific downregulation of Zif268 mRNA in the NAc Core. Altogether, our results show that PPX restores impulse control in highly impulsive rats by modulation of limbic frontostriatal circuits.

Abstract
Technology-based gambling prevalence is not well understood since relevant questions are not included in health and disease surveillance studies. The current study sought to estimate the prevalence of internet-based and smartphone app-based gambling, along with casino gambling, in a sample of U.S. young adults and determine if gambling modality was associated with problem gambling symptoms or substance use. The 2022 Rhode Island Young Adult Survey included N = 1,022 students between the ages of 18 to 25 years old who had lived in Rhode Island, with n = 414 lifetime gamblers (40.5%) included in this study. Odds of gambling via a smartphone app and on the internet, respectively, were greater in heterosexual cis-males compared to heterosexual cis-females (OR[95%CI] = 3.14 [1.25,7.91]; OR[95%CI] = 6.30 [2.05,19.3]). Internet gambling amongst employed students was less common than among those who were not a student and not employed (OR[95%CI] = 0.25 [0.06,1.00]). Odds of problem gambling symptoms were higher among those who gambled via a smartphone app (OR[95%CI] = 3.23 [1.21,8.60]). All forms of gambling were associated with alcohol consumption, although the strength of the association was stronger in app and internet gamblers. Casino gamblers were more likely to be high risk marijuana and illicit drug users. The rising availability of app gambling coupled with its social, psychological, and cultural context may presents an alternative pathway to problem gambling. Bans on internet gambling and/or strict guidelines on the frequency of wagers and cash placed per wager, should be considered as viable methods to mitigate associated consequences.

Abstract
BACKGROUND Increasing evidence suggests an association between third-generation antipsychotics (TGAs) and impulse control disorders (ICDs). This is thought to be due to their partial agonism of dopamine receptors. However, neither the relative nor absolute risks of ICDs in those prescribed TGAs are well established. To inform clinical practice, this systematic review and meta-analysis summarizes and quantifies the current evidence for an association. METHODS An electronic search of Medline, PsychINFO, EMBASE, and the Cochrane Clinical Trials Database was undertaken from database inception to November 2022. Three reviewers screened abstracts and reviewed full texts for inclusion. A random-effects meta-analysis was conducted with eligible studies. RESULTS A total of 392 abstracts were retrieved, 214 remained after duplicates were removed. Fifteen full texts were reviewed, of which 8 were included. All 8 studies found that TGAs were associated with increased probability of ICDs. Risk of bias was high or critical in 7 of 8 studies. Three studies were included in the pooled analysis for the primary outcome, 2 with data on each of aripiprazole, cariprazine, and brexpiprazole. Exposure to TGAs versus other antipsychotics was associated with an increase in ICDs (pooled odds ratio, 5.54; 2.24-13.68). Cariprazine and brexpiprazole were significantly associated with ICDs when analyzed individually. Aripiprazole trended toward increased risk, but very wide confidence intervals included no effect. CONCLUSIONS Third-generation antipsychotics were associated with increased risk of ICDs in all studies included and pooled analysis. However, the risk of bias is high, confidence intervals are wide, and the quality of evidence is very low for all TGAs examined.

Abstract
BACKGROUND AND AIMS Numerous studies point to the comorbidity between gambling disorder (GD) and attention deficit hyperactivity disorder (ADHD). However, there is a lack of research exploring how ADHD symptoms might influence psychological treatment outcomes for GD. Therefore, we aimed to explore differences between patients with GD with and without self-reported ADHD symptoms regarding psychopathology, personality, sociodemographic and treatment outcome measures. METHOD This longitudinal study included 170 patients with GD receiving cognitive behavioral therapy. Multiple self-reported instruments were used to assess clinical variables and sociodemographic measures prior to treatment. RESULTS A clinical profile characterized by greater GD severity, higher psychopathology and impulsivity, and less adaptive personality features was observed in patients with self-reported ADHD symptoms compared to those without. No significant differences in treatment response (measured by dropout and relapse rates) were observed between the two groups. However, patients with self-reported ADHD symptoms experienced more severe relapses (i.e., gambled more money) and GD patients who relapsed scored higher on measures of ADHD, particularly inattention. CONCLUSION Individuals with GD and self-reported symptoms of ADHD may experience more severe relapses following treatment, suggesting a need for more vigilant follow-up and interventions for patients with this comorbidity.

Abstract
The co-occurrence between gambling disorder (GD) and problematic pornography use (PPU) has not yet been explored. Therefore, the present study compared (a) sociodemographic variables, (b) GD-related factors, (c) substance use, (d) psychopathology, (e) personality features, (f) impulsivity, and (g) emotion regulation between individuals with GD (GD group) and those with co-occurring GD and PPU (GD+PPU group). The sample consisted of 359 treatment-seeking individuals with GD: n = 332 individuals had GD only (GD group) and n = 37 individuals had GD and co-occurring PPU (GD+PPU group). GD severity, impulsivity, psychopathology, personality, emotion regulation, and other sociodemographic and clinical variables were assessed. No between-group differences in sociodemographic measures were observed. The GD+PPU group demonstrated greater GD severity and a higher likelihood of substance use compared to those without PPU. Furthermore, the presence of PPU was associated with worse psychopathology, higher impulsivity (except for lack of premeditation and positive urgency), more difficulties in emotion regulation (except for non-acceptance of emotions and limited access to emotions), and a personality profile characterized by lower levels of self-directedness and cooperativeness. The co-occurrence of GD and PPU seems associated with a more dysfunctional clinical profile.

Abstract
Early age of gambling onset, ease of gambling with technological developments and lack of controlling online gambling games have led to unmanageable risk of gambling. Individual-centered approaches play a significant role in managing the risk that gambling poses on public health and discerning the heterogeneity of gambling addiction. Therefore, this study employed Latent Profile Analysis (LPA), one of the individual-centered approaches, to model the interactions across the psychosocial characteristics of gamblers. The study aims to reveal the latent profiles of gambling addiction. Unlike variable-centered approaches, LPA is a contemporary technique that provides objective information regarding individual psychological processes and behaviors. The profile indicators of the study involve psychosocial characteristics such as resilience, motives to gamble (excitement/fun, avoidance, making money, socializing), purposefulness, responsibility and worthiness. Data were collected from 317 volunteers (M = 68.9%; F = 31.1%; mean age = 25.16 ± 6.46) through the Brief Resilience Scale (BRS), Gambling Motives Scale (GMS) and Personal Virtues Scale (PVS). The emerging profiles were defined as adventurous players (14.2%), social gamblers (9.8%), professional gamblers (32.8%), problem gamblers (24.6%) and avoidant gamblers (18.6%). The individual-centered modeling is congruent with the literature on gambling and provides a complementary perspective to understand the heterogeneous structure of gambling. The results are expected to assist mental health professionals in developing educational and clinical intervention programs for gambling behavior. Finally yet importantly, it is recommended that new LPA models be offered through the use of different indicators related to gambling addiction.

Abstract
Background and aims Increasingly, gambling features migrate into non-gambling platforms (e.g., online gaming) making gambling exposure and problems more likely. Therefore, exploring how to best treat gambling disorder (GD) remains important. Our aim was to review systematically and quantitatively synthesize the available evidence on psychological intervention for GD. Methods Records were identified through searches for randomized controlled trials (RCTs) evaluating psychological intervention for GD via six academic databases without date restrictions until February 3, 2023. Study quality was assessed with the revised Cochrane risk-of-bias tool for randomized trials (RoB2). Primary outcomes were GD symptom severity and remission of GD, summarized as Hedges' g and odds ratios, respectively. The study was preregistered in PROSPERO (#CRD42021284550). Results Of 5,541 records, 29 RCTs (3,083 participants analyzed) were included for meta-analysis of the primary outcomes. The efficacy of psychological intervention across modality, format and mode of delivery corresponded to a medium effect on gambling severity (g = -0.71) and a small effect on remission (OR = 0.47). Generally, risk of bias was high, particularly amongst early face-to-face interventions studies. Discussion and conclusions The results indicate that psychological intervention is efficacious in treating GD, with face-to-face delivered intervention producing the largest effects and with strongest evidence for cognitive behavioral therapy. Much remains to be known about the long-term effects, and investigating a broader range of treatment modalities and digital interventions is a priority if we are to improve clinical practice for this heterogeneous patient group.

Abstract
Background The neurobiological mechanisms of gambling disorder are not yet fully characterized, limiting the development of treatments. Defects in frontostriatal connections have been shown to play a major role in substance use disorders, but data on behavioral addictions, such as gambling disorder, are scarce. The aim of this study was to 1) investigate whether gambling disorder is associated with abnormal frontostriatal connectivity and 2) characterize the key neurotransmitter systems underlying the connectivity abnormalities. Methods Fifteen individuals with gambling disorder and 17 matched healthy controls were studied with resting-state functional connectivity MRI and three brain positron emission tomography scans, investigating dopamine (18F-FDOPA), opioid (11C-carfentanil) and serotonin (11C-MADAM) function. Frontostriatal connectivity was investigated using striatal seed-to-voxel connectivity and compared between the groups. Neurotransmitter systems underlying the identified connectivity differences were investigated using region-of-interest and voxelwise approaches. Results Individuals with gambling disorder showed loss of functional connectivity between the right nucleus accumbens (NAcc) and a region in the right dorsolateral prefrontal cortex (DLPFC) (PFWE <0.05). Similarly, there was a significant Group x right NAcc interaction in right DLPFC 11C-MADAM binding (p = 0.03) but not in 18F-FDOPA uptake or 11C-carfentanil binding. This was confirmed in voxelwise analyses showing a widespread Group x right NAcc interaction in the prefrontal cortex 11C-MADAM binding (PFWE <0.05). Right NAcc 11C-MADAM binding potential correlated with attentional impulsivity in individuals with gambling disorder (r = -0.73, p = 0.005). Discussion Gambling disorder is associated with right hemisphere abnormal frontostriatal connectivity and serotonergic function. These findings will contribute to understanding the neurobiological mechanism and may help identify potential treatment targets for gambling disorder.

Abstract
This research empirically tests the relationship between gambling-related cognitive distortions and the development of gambling problems. In two separate studies using methodologies designed to support non-experimental causal inference, we demonstrate that holding false beliefs about gambling experiences is related to current and future risk of developing problems with gambling. In our first study, we use an instrumental variable estimation strategy on an internet sample (n = 184) and observe a statistically significant relationship between Gamblers' Belief Questionnaire scores and measures of loss chasing, overspending, and gambling problems. These findings were robust to linear and ordinal estimation strategies and multiple model specifications. In our second study, we examine five-year prospective longitudinal data (n = 1,431) to validate our initial findings and test whether irrational thoughts are also related to future problems with gambling. While controlling for current fallacies, we find that past Gambling Fallacies Measure scores are related to present gambling problems across two survey waves. The effect size of each of the past fallacy levels is roughly half of the effect size of present levels, suggesting meaningful impacts. Our findings support the Pathways Model of Problem and Pathological Gambling.

Abstract
Introduction Previous research has established co-occurrence between substance use disorders (SUDs) and gambling disorder (GD). Less well understood is the temporal sequencing of onset between these disorders, and in particular whether SUD is a risk factor for GD. The present study examined the temporal order between registered diagnoses of SUD and GD, stratified by sex. Methods A study with a longitudinal design using objective registry data drawn from the Norwegian Patient Registry was carried out. Among the patients with a registered diagnosis of GD between 2008 and 2018 (N = 5,131; males = 81.8%), those (who in addition) had a registered diagnosis of any SUD (n = 1,196; males = 82.1%) were included. The measures included a registered diagnosis using the ICD-10 of both GD (code F63.0) and SUDs (codes F10-F19) by a health care professional. Binomial tests were used to identify the temporal order between SUD(s) and GD. Co-occurring cases (i.e., cases diagnosed within the same month) were removed in the main analyses. Results Results showed a significant directional path from SUD to GD but no support for the reversed path (i.e., from GD to SUD). This finding was similar overall for (i) both males and females, (ii) when different SUDs (alcohol, cannabis, sedatives, and polysubstance) were examined individually, and (iii) when specifying a 12-month time-lag between diagnoses. Conclusions The findings suggest that experiencing SUD(s) is a risk marker for GD given the temporal precedence observed for patients in specialised healthcare services seeking treatment. These results should be considered alongside screening and prevention efforts for GD.

Abstract
Problem gambling levels amongst elite sportspeople are above populational baseline. We assess gambling in an elite Irish sporting population. An anonymous web-based questionnaire including the validated Problem Gambling Severity Index was distributed. Univariate and multivariate analyses were performed to evaluate predictors of moderate/high risk gambling. 608 players (mean age 24) were included. Seventy nine percent of respondents were current gamblers and 6% problem gamblers. Amongst high-risk gamblers, significantly more were male (100% vs 76%, p = 0.003), fewer completed university (52% vs 69%, p = 0.024), and more were smokers (48% vs 24%, p = 0.002). They were also more likely to avail of free online gambling offers (90% vs 44%, p < 0.001), gamble with teammates (52% vs 21%, p < 0.001) and have placed their first bet before age 16 (41% vs 19%, p = 0.003). In multivariate analysis, moderate/high risk gambling was associated with: male gender (OR = 8.9 [1.1-69], p = 0.035), no 3rd level education (OR = 2.5 [1.4-5.0], p = 0.002), free online gambling use (OR = 4.3 [2.1-5.3], p < 0.001), gambling with teammates (OR = 3.0 [1.7-5.3], p < 0.001), and being under 18 at first bet (OR = 2.0 [1.1-3.3], p = 0.013). This study shows a harmful gambling culture amongst elite Irish athletes. Male gender, lower educational status, free online gambling use, gambling with teammates and first bet at less than age 18 were associated with moderate/high risk gambling. These groups may benefit from targeted interventions.

Abstract
Aim: To study the prevalence and patterns of problematic gaming and gambling during the COVID-19 pandemic and the association with psychiatric traits and major types of anxiety categories. Method: 1067 young adults participated in both wave 3 (2018) and wave 4 (2021) of the SALVe Cohort. Associations with psychiatric symptoms and anxiety were examined using logistic regression and Chi-square tests. Results: Problematic gaming decreased by 1.3 percentage points to 23.2% since the start of the pandemic, while problematic gambling increased by 0.9 percentage points to 6.5% in w4. Average time spent playing video games/day decreased from 2.2 h (w3) to 1.7 h (w4), while increases in gaming activity were associated with worsened feelings of loneliness (p = 0.002), depression (p < 0.001), and anxiety (p < 0.01) during the pandemic. Predictors for problematic gaming at w4 were previous problematic gaming and social anxiety (p = < 0.001 and 0.01, respectively). Moreover, previous problem gambling also predicted problem gambling at w4 p < 0.001. All anxiety categories were associated with both problematic gaming and gambling when adjusted for age and sex. However, after adjusting for depression and insomnia, social anxiety was associated with problematic gaming (p < 0.001), while panic was associated with problem gambling (p < 0.001). Conclusion: Overall, problematic gaming has decreased since the start of the pandemic, while problem gambling has increased. Worsened feelings of loneliness, depression, and anxiety during the pandemic are associated with increased gaming. Moreover, the association between problematic gaming and gambling and anxiety is independent of depression and sleep problems.

Abstract
Previous research has identified attentional biases towards addiction-related stimuli, including gambling-related stimuli. Eye-tracking is considered the gold standard methodology for measuring attentional biases, yet no review to date has examined its use in measuring gambling-related attentional biases. This systematic review synthesized the literature using eye-tracking to examine attentional biases among people who gamble. We reviewed articles from Web of Science and PubMed that were published from 1990 to 2021. A total of 11 articles were included, with sample sizes ranging from 38 to 173 participants. Of these studies, seven examined attentional biases for gambling-related visual stimuli. These seven studies provided support that gambling can result in the development of an attentional bias for gambling-related stimuli. With respect to correlates of gambling-related attentional biases, there were mixed results. Some studies identified significant positive associations between gambling-related attentional biases and psychosocial variables, such as problem gambling severity, gambling expectancies, gambling cravings, gambling motives, depressive symptom severity, alcohol use severity, daily stress, affective impulsivity, and immersion. Four studies examined attentional biases for responsible gambling messaging and advertisements, finding that both people who do and do not gamble attend less to responsible gambling messaging compared to other types of information such as the betting odds. Research using eye-tracking to examine attentional biases among people who gamble is in its infancy. Yet, the preliminary results support the identification of attentional biases using the gold-standard methodology. Further studies are needed to examine the correlates and potential clinical utility of assessing gambling-related attentional biases using eye-tracking.

Abstract
PURPOSE OF REVIEW Modern methods of communication and engagement, such as social media, video games, and online shopping, use a variety of behavioral techniques to encourage and reward frequent use, opening the door to addiction. The technological addictions (TAs) are a set of disorders that accompany the technological advances that define the digital age. The TAs are an active source of research in the literature, with promising treatment options already available. RECENT FINDINGS There are promising therapeutic and psychopharmacologic treatments for a broad range of TAs. Stimulants, antidepressants, and cognitive therapies may all be effective for internet gaming disorder (IGD). Cognitive therapies may be effective for other TAs, such as social media addiction (SMA), online shopping addiction (OSA), and online porn addiction. Society's dependence on addictive technologies will only increase. Many of the TAs can be addressed with medication and therapy, with more research and literature developing at a rapid pace.
Collapse
Key Words
- Cybersex – online sexual activity, experienced alone or with others, that may involve technologies such as apps, webcams, or virtual reality that is not necessarily indicative of a disorder
- Internet addiction (IA) – an antiquated term which referred to addiction to the internet broadly speaking. It has largely been replaced with more specific terms
- Internet gaming disorder (IGD) – persistent overuse videogames leading to clinically significant impairment or distress played alone or with others online
- Online shopping addiction (OSA) – problematic shopping behavior via the internet that may be excessive, compulsive, and that causes economic, social, and emotional consequences
- Social media addiction (SMA) – preoccupation with social media, evidenced by irresistible urges to use and increasing time spent using online platforms, resulting in impairment or distress
- Technological addictions (TAs) – behavioral addictions that result from overutilization of modern technologies, many of which are necessary parts of everyday life today

Abstract
BACKGROUND Abnormal interactions among addiction brain networks associated with intoxication, negative affect, and anticipation may have relevance for internet gaming disorder (IGD). Despite prior studies having identified gender-related differences in the neural correlates of IGD, gender-related differences in the involvement of brain networks remain unclear. METHODS One-hundred-and-nine individuals with IGD (54 males) and 111 with recreational game use (RGU; 58 males) provided resting-state fMRI data. We examined gender-related differences in involvement of addiction brain networks in IGD versus RGU subjects. We further compared the strength between and within addiction brain networks and explored possible relationships between the strength of functional connectivities within and between addiction brain networks and several relevant behavioral measures. RESULTS The addiction brain networks showed high correct classification rates in distinguishing IGD and RGU subjects in men and women. Male subjects with versus without IGD showed stronger functional connectivities between and within addiction brain networks. Moreover, the strength of the connectivity within the anticipation network in male IGD subjects was positively related to subjective craving. However, female subjects with versus without IGD showed decreased functional connections between and within addiction brain networks. The strength of connectivity between the anticipation and negative-affect brain networks in female IGD subjects was negatively related to maladaptive cognitive emotion-regulation strategies. CONCLUSIONS Addiction brain networks have potential for distinguishing IGD and RGU individuals. Importantly, this study identified novel gender-related differences in brain-behavior relationships in IGD. These results help advance current neuroscientific theories of IGD and may inform gender-informed treatment strategies.

Abstract
In 2020, the World Health Organization formally recognized addiction to digital technology (connected devices) as a worldwide problem, where excessive online activity and internet use lead to inability to manage time, energy, and attention during daytime and produce disturbed sleep patterns or insomnia during nighttime. Recent studies have shown that the problem has increased in magnitude worldwide during the COVID-19 pandemic. The extent to which dysfunctional sleep is a consequence of altered motivation, memory function, mood, diet, and other lifestyle variables or results from excess of blue-light exposure when looking at digital device screens for long hours at day and night is one of many still unresolved questions. This article offers a narrative overview of some of the most recent literature on this topic. The analysis provided offers a conceptual basis for understanding digital addiction as one of the major reasons why people, and adolescents in particular, sleep less and less well in the digital age. It discusses definitions as well as mechanistic model accounts in context. Digital addiction is identified as functionally equivalent to all addictions, characterized by the compulsive, habitual, and uncontrolled use of digital devices and an excessively repeated engagement in a particular online behavior. Once the urge to be online has become uncontrollable, it is always accompanied by severe sleep loss, emotional distress, depression, and memory dysfunction. In extreme cases, it may lead to suicide. The syndrome has been linked to the known chronic effects of all drugs, producing disturbances in cellular and molecular mechanisms of the GABAergic and glutamatergic neurotransmitter systems. Dopamine and serotonin synaptic plasticity, essential for impulse control, memory, and sleep function, are measurably altered. The full spectrum of behavioral symptoms in digital addicts include eating disorders and withdrawal from outdoor and social life. Evidence pointing towards dysfunctional melatonin and vitamin D metabolism in digital addicts should be taken into account for carving out perspectives for treatment. The conclusions offer a holistic account for digital addiction, where sleep deficit is one of the key factors.
